Ball-and-stick model of a glyphosate molecule, C3H8NO5P, as found in the crystal structure reported in CrystEngComm (2023) 25, 988–997 and CSD entry PHOGLY05. The molecule exists as a zwitterion, the acidic phosphoric acid group having donated a proton to the basic amino group. Colour code:
